Sony Handycam HDR-TG7VEOnce you've shot a lot of footage with your camcorder, it takes time and effort to edit the results together and produce your own ‘mini movies'. The camcorder automatically picks and assembles clips together, adding professional-looking transition effects and a music soundtrack. |

Sony Handycam HDR-TG3E
by robert_p - written on 12/11/08 (Useful, 530 readings)
Rating:
the upright layout, Sony have made this camera small and light enough to slip into a trouser pocket. Truly portable. Picture quality is wonderful, with a variety of recording modes available to either capture highest quality or maximise the recording time available. Face detection chooses focus well, even indoors. Sony Handycam HDR-SR10E
by bjarvis2785 - written on 06/01/09 (Very useful, 358 readings)
Rating:
In typical Sony style, as soon as you open up the box, this camcorder looks great! Small, sleek and stylish you instantly know that you won t be looking out of place with this beauty. It s small size does take a little getting used to, and finding the best grip is very important so that you can reach the necessary buttons with your thumb and fore-finger. Once the grip is sorted, everything you need is in easy reach - the on/off (and quick-on - kind of like a sleep mode) and the all important record button is at the tip of where your thumb rests.
